The 3.4 million AD plant was officially opened by Lord Henley, minister for recycling, on Friday (July 1). The facility, close to the farm which makes yogurt and other products, has received 1.2 million of funding from the Anaerobic Digestion Demonstration Programme which is administered by the Waste & Resources Action Programme (WRAP) and the Carbon Trust.
But, it has emerged that there are concerns that some of the local authorities in the county, notably Plymouth, may not choose to separately sort food waste for anaerobic digestion and instead will make use of energy from waste plants which are proposed for Plymouth and Exeter. This would mean less material for Langage Farm and other AD plants in the region.
And, the local authority in which Langage Farm is situated, South Hams district council, sends its household food waste to the Heathfield in-vessel composting plant at Kingsteignton which is operated by Viridor. The material is collected mixed with green waste – commercial food waste collected by the district is going to Langage Farm.
WRAP has said that by the end of its first year of operation, the Langage Farm AD facility will process 12,000 tonnes of food waste collected from households across the county by local authorities.
According to the original project plan for the plant it was to take in only 8,000 tonnes of food waste annually with 3,000 tonnes of material coming in the form of slurry from the Langage Farm cattle herd. Additionally, some food wastewas expected to come from industrial sources. Since the plan was drawn up in 2009, the plant’s capacity has been increased and it is licensed totake 20,000 tonnes of waste in total.
Closed loop
Speaking at the opening, Lord Henley said: The facility at Langage Farm is an excellent working example of how a localised closed loop economy can be created. Food waste that otherwise would have gone to landfill will instead be used to produce the energy that will power much of the production process here on the farm, helping to produce award winning clotted cream, ice cream and yoghurt.
Marcus Gover, director of organics and energy from waste at WRAP, said he believed the market, including investors, developers and end users, should be confident of AD as a reliable, safe and profitable resource efficiency process.
He added: AD is a growing part of the resource efficiency solution, capable of diverting biodegradable waste from landfill, creating renewable energy, stimulating the green economy and improving the sustainability of commercial agriculture. We really see it as a huge opportunity for the UK.
Source separated
John Dean, of Langage Farms, told letsrecycle.com that the plant would be taking food waste locally and from further afield. We would like to see a lot more source separated food waste collections, even with plastic bags, as we can deal with that.
And, Mr Dean confirmed that input material will be coming from a variety of sources including from industrial sources. Gate fees for the plant have not been disclosed but will be below landfill costs and depend on factors such as contamination levels, the calorific value of the food waste and its nutrient potential.
The plant uses Finsterwalder Umwelttechnik technology from Germany and has suffered from exchange rate changes in the past with a rise in forecasted costs making a “significant dent in the budget”. Heat produced by the AD plant will be sufficient to supply the entire needs of the existing diary products factory, and will also produce electricity which will be fed back into the National Grid. The plant will also produce a high quality nutrient rich organic fertiliser for use on nearby pastureland.
